Mortgage brokers in Hales Corners Wisconsin help home buyers and refinancing homeowners find suitable loan products from multiple lenders. Wisconsin law requires mortgage brokers to be licensed through the Nationwide Multistate Licensing System and comply with state regulations under Chapter 138 of the Wisconsin Statutes. Working with a local broker can provide insight into Hales Corners market conditions and specific property types common in Milwaukee County.
What Does a Mortgage Broker in Hales Corners Cost?
Mortgage broker fees in Wisconsin typically range from 1% to 2% of the loan amount. For a $300,000 home loan, this means $3,000 to $6,000 in broker compensation. Some brokers charge a flat fee of $2,500 to $5,000. Costs vary based on loan type, credit profile, and lender terms. This is general information and not mortgage or financial advice.
